Position Summary
The Senior Buyer partners with Engineers and Leadership in order to procure raw materials, components, supplies and services in sufficient quantities to provide for a 100% customer service level, while achieving the targeted Quality & Cost objectives.
This position reports to the Senior Materials Manager.
What You’ll Be Doing as Senior Buyer
Function as an active member of the supply chain team by processing purchase requisitions, managing approved suppliers and issuing purchase orders according to company procedures Assist in the implementation of sourcing & commodity strategies for all goods and/or services to achieve improvements in all areas of quality, cost and delivery Assist in expediting supplier shipments; identifying and resolving any potential delays while keeping all internal and external customers informed of any materials delays or problems including customs delays Share responsibility of recording receipts and closing purchase orders and assisting in the resolution of invoicing discrepancies Manage material costs, perform cost comparisons, and identify cost savings opportunities available Participate in cost savings initiatives and annual physical inventory process Develop and implement cost reduction, cost avoidance and cost containment Monitor supplier performance and address non-conformances Maintain supplier data in ERP system and purchasing files Prepare reports/analyses as requested by managementWhat You Bring to the Table as Senior Buyer
